Subject: Key rotation — Dunlief SDK parity service

The old key for the parity-diff service is revoked as of today. This affects the checks comparing the Marrowel Java and Swift SDKs before each release cut. Update your release scripts before the next cut or parity gating will fail. The new key for the parity-diff service is below.

API key for fahif-bahop: vxb23-B1zKyQaAnaG4Gma9WuizPfB

Handover: Timezone handling in Fernhollow report exports

Welcome aboard. The export service stores all timestamps in UTC, but the scheduler converts to each workspace's locale at render time using the tzmap table — never trust the client offset. Watch for the DST edge case in the Marlowe region profile; there's a pinned test covering it. If the tzmap cache corrupts, exports will silently shift by one hour, and you must rebuild it from the sealed snapshot. Unsealing that snapshot requires the recovery passphrase below.

strongbox words: norwyn-wenael-aldvan-aldiel-wendor-holael

Onboarding: Seedloom test-data factory

Seedloom generates deterministic fixtures for every service in the Bramleyworks stack. New team members should install the CLI, then create a local env file in the repo root. Set SEEDLOOM_PROFILE=local and SEEDLOOM_SEED=42 so your fixtures match everyone else's. Factories that emit user records call the anonymization service, which requires a shared secret in the same env file. Add that secret as the next line before running your first generation pass.

sealed setting: ARCHIVE_KEY3=8d0

Welcome aboard. Bucketloom assigns users to experiment variants via a deterministic hash of user ID plus experiment salt, so assignments are stable across sessions without storing state. The tricky parts: holdout groups are carved out before bucketing, and the exposure logger batches events, so counts lag dashboards by a few minutes. Don't change salts on running experiments — it reshuffles everyone. Deploys go out Mondays; the staging cluster mirrors prod traffic at ten percent. The service boots from the configuration shown below.

deployment values, fahap-hahaf:
[casdor]
port = 9200
region = south-2
host = casdor.qirvanworks.corp
timeout_ms = 3000
retries = 4